    What exactly do you do in DoD?
     
  24. Dan

    Dan Jedi Grand Master star 6

    Registered:
    Mar 15, 1999
    DoD is WWII based. Axis vs. Americans. 4 different classes: light infantry (3 grenades, fast, little armor, great stamina, rifle that holds a clip of 5 and you have to cock after each shot); sniper (never use it cause my net connection sux0rs, but it's a sniper hehe); assault infantry (medium speed and stamina, machine gun, 1 grenade, decent armor); heavy infantry (big machine gun, slow speed, etc. you can figure it out, lol).

    Maps are based on either setting explosives to objectives (similar to CS) or controlling all the flag points on a map.

    The game is less skill based, imo. You don't have to burst fire and jumping isn't nearly as high. Strafing doesn't go as fast as in CS. Although there are 4 classes, you cannot pick up a gun from a dead person in another class. i.e. you can't have a light infantry dude running around with 10 grenades and a big heavy assault machine gun. And another difference is that you can lie prone in Dod.

    I actually prefer DoD to CS, even though I've been playing more CS over the last month (and I still suck at it, while I'm very good at Dod).
